AI's Role in Expanding the Superstar Gap
Artificial Intelligence (AI) has emerged as a transformative force across global economies, but its impact is far from uniform. Experts and recent reports warn that AI is poised to widen the economic and social gap between high-performing “superstars” and the rest of the workforce, both within countries and internationally. This growing divide raises critical questions about inequality, workforce disruption, and the future distribution of wealth and power.
The Superstar Effect Amplified by AI
The core idea, highlighted in a recent Wall Street Journal discussion, is that AI technologies disproportionately benefit those already at the top of their fields—the so-called "superstars." These individuals or companies, equipped with superior skills, capital, or infrastructure, can leverage AI tools to multiply their productivity and influence dramatically. Meanwhile, those with fewer resources or lower skill levels face stagnation or displacement.
According to the Stanford Institute for Human-Centered Artificial Intelligence, without deliberate intervention, AI may cause "greater concentrations of wealth and power for the elite few" while leaving the majority "in poverty and powerlessness." This reflects a classic pattern seen historically with technological revolutions, but AI accelerates the effect by automating tasks and augmenting human capabilities at an unprecedented scale.
Unequal Adoption and Economic Consequences
This gap is not just about individual talents but also about geographic and institutional advantages. For example, a Brookings Institution report notes that cities like Los Angeles are rapidly adopting AI, but ensuring that all workers, especially marginalized Black and Brown communities, benefit remains a challenge. The well-paid nature of AI-related jobs tends to concentrate wealth in hands already positioned to capitalize on technology, exacerbating existing inequalities.
Internationally, the divide is even starker. Southeast Asia exemplifies this risk: developed countries in the region with better digital infrastructure and workforce skills are poised to gain from AI, while less developed nations lag behind. Joanne Lin, a senior fellow at the ISEAS – Yusof Ishak Institute, warns that AI will "widen gaps in Southeast Asia," as poorer countries struggle to build the infrastructure and education systems required to compete.
Labor Market Disruption and Vulnerable Groups
AI’s impact on the labor market is profound and uneven. An Access Partnership study estimated that 57% of Southeast Asia’s workforce, or about 164 million people, could see their jobs reshaped or disrupted by AI. Low-skilled and mid-skilled roles—especially in service industries such as call centers, payroll, finance, and business process outsourcing—are most vulnerable to automation.
In Malaysia, analysts have observed that women, younger workers, and those in predictable clerical roles are at higher risk of job losses due to AI’s capabilities to replicate structured tasks. This trend suggests that AI could exacerbate existing inequalities within countries, hitting the most vulnerable workers hardest.
The Role of Education and Infrastructure
The disparity in AI benefits is tightly linked to disparities in digital infrastructure and education quality. Countries and regions with advanced technology ecosystems, high-quality education systems, and strong investment in AI research and development are set to reap outsized benefits. Conversely, those with limited infrastructure and educational resources face an uphill battle.
Experts argue that addressing these gaps requires urgent policy focus on inclusive AI development, education reform, and digital access expansion. Without such measures, AI risks entrenching and expanding economic and social divides.
Implications for Policy and Society
The widening gap between superstars and others calls for a multifaceted response:
- Workforce retraining and education must prioritize digital and AI literacy to prepare broader populations for the evolving labor market.
- Equity-focused AI policies should ensure that benefits are more evenly distributed, including support for marginalized communities.
- Investment in infrastructure is critical, particularly in developing economies, to enable participation in the AI-driven economy.
- Corporate responsibility is essential, as leading firms wielding AI power should contribute to societal wellbeing beyond profit maximization.
Failure to address these issues risks deepening inequality, social unrest, and economic polarization.
